Teag Otracey 34.200 I BA £64.10.6 Jun 18 1712
Appraisers: Nicholas Heaile, Moses Edwards.
Creditors: Edward Stevenson.
Next of kin: Susan Tracy, Thomas Carr.
===
Teage Tracey 35B.29 A BA £64.6.0 £20.13.6 Jul 29 1713
Payments to: Edward Stevenson, James Crooke, William Holland, William Wheeler, John Israel, Barberry (no surname given), George Newport.
Administratrix: Mary Hitchcoke, wife of George Hitchcoke (planter).
===
Teage Tracy 36A.145 A BA £64.6.6 £8.18.11 Aug 31 1714
Payments to: John Hurst, James Pattison, Thomas Hutchins, Mr. Richard Colegate, Sarah Spinks, John Stokes, W. Bladen, Esq.
Administratrix: Mary Tracy represented by George Hitchcock.
===
Thomas Thompson (planter) 21.313 I AA Dec 31 1701
Appraisers: George Simmons, Teague Tracy.

Walter Morrow (inholder) 30.432 I BA £37.l0.3 Dec 5 1709
The amount of the inventory also included #3044.
Appraisers: Mr. Thomas Hutchins, Mr. Oliver Harraot (also Oliver Harriot). Creditors: Oliver Harriot, Isaac Samson, Susanna Adams.
Next of kin: John Morrow.
List of debts: John Christian, Teage Tracy, Col. John Thomas, John Gay, Anthony Demondidere, John Cook.
Administrators: John Morrow, William Pecket.
